Index of /_SITEIMAGE/view/c2hvcC1waGluZi5wc3RhdGljLm5ldA/74/72/23/d6
Name
Last modified
Size
Description
Parent Directory
-
747223d6a1b0c7ddf976..>
2024-06-25 07:02
101K